- Equipment &1 ?The SAP error message CCMM039 typically relates to issues with equipment in the context of SAP's Plant Maintenance (PM) or Controlling (CO) modules. The message usually indicates that there is a problem with the equipment master data or its configuration.
Cause:
The error message CCMM039 "Equipment &1" generally occurs due to one of the following reasons:
- Missing Equipment Master Data: The equipment specified in the error message does not exist in the system or is not properly configured.
- Incorrect Status: The equipment may be in a status that does not allow certain operations (e.g., it might be marked as inactive).
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access or modify the equipment data.
-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the data related to the equipment, such as missing fields or incorrect entries.
Solution:
To resolve the CCMM039 error, you can take the following steps:
Check Equipment Master Data:
- Go to the transaction code IE03 (Display Equipment) and enter the equipment number mentioned in the error message.
- Verify that the equipment exists and is correctly configured.
Review Equipment Status:
- Ensure that the equipment is in an active status. If it is inactive, you may need to change its status to active.
Authorization Check:
-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access and modify the equipment data. You may need to consult with your SAP security team.
Data Consistency Check:
- Check for any inconsistencies in the equipment data. This may involve reviewing related master data or configuration settings.
